The present invention relates to a rubber composition for a tire tread including a rosin-modified terpene phenol resin. According to the present invention, when applying rosin-modified terpene phenol resin to a tire tread, a gripping force, especially a gripping force on a wet road surface, is improved to be used in manufacturing a high performance tire, thereby increasing the competitiveness of a product.
